Scholarships are a great way to help pay for college, but they can be difficult to obtain. Meeting the requirements for a scholarship can be a daunting task, but it is possible with the right approach. Here are some tips to help you meet the requirements for a scholarship.
1. Read the Requirements Carefully: Before you apply for a scholarship, make sure you read the requirements carefully. Pay attention to the details and make sure you understand what is expected of you. This will help you make sure you meet all the requirements and give you the best chance of being accepted.
2. Follow the Instructions: Once you have read the requirements, make sure you follow the instructions. This includes submitting all the necessary documents and information on time. If you don’t follow the instructions, your application may be rejected.
3. Be Organized: Being organized is key when applying for a scholarship. Make sure you keep track of all the documents and information you need to submit. This will help you stay on top of the application process and make sure you don’t miss any important deadlines.
4. Get Help: If you are having trouble meeting the requirements for a scholarship, don’t be afraid to ask for help. Talk to your guidance counselor or a financial aid advisor at your school. They can provide valuable advice and resources to help you meet the requirements.
5. Don’t Give Up: Applying for scholarships can be a long and difficult process. Don’t give up if you don’t get accepted the first time. Keep trying and you may eventually find a scholarship that is right for you.
